Output 27a5ccf28e2e4d758d29c36b548bfbb6e245bfcc062da7a1d158ca837cf551e3:0

value
2812976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ff9172c9ee5ae2355804e4805c1f3eff266f7ad OP_EQUAL
address
3HjUaE8Mc39wWUbw7c6hfFh4rQGAjA5q5S
transaction
27a5ccf28e2e4d758d29c36b548bfbb6e245bfcc062da7a1d158ca837cf551e3
spent
true